What is Zucchini Fritters Air Fryer

These zucchini fritters air fryer are a savory snack made primarily from grated zucchini, combined with a few simple ingredients like flour, cheese, and eggs. Cooked in an air fryer, they achieve a crispy exterior while maintaining a soft, tender interior. This cooking method helps to cut down on excess oil while still delivering that satisfying crunch you crave.

Ingredients You Need

  • 2 medium zucchinis, grated: Provides the main flavor and texture.
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t: Enhances the overall taste of the fritters.
  • 1/4 cup all-purpose flour: Binds the ingredients together for a cohesive texture.
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ese: Adds a savory flavor and boosts the nutritional profile with calcium.
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per: Provides a hint of heat and depth to the flavor.
  • 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der: Infuses a rich, aromatic flavor.
  • 1/2 teaspoon onion powder: Complements the garlic and adds a savory note.
  • 1 large egg, beaten: Acts as a binding agent to hold the fritters together.
  • Cooking spray: Necessary for achieving that crispy texture in the air fryer.

How to Make Zucchini Fritters Air Fryer Step by Step

  1. Start by grating the zucchinis using a box grater or food processor. Place them in a clean kitchen towel and squeeze out excess moisture.
  2. Pro Tip: Removing excess moisture is crucial for achieving crispy fritters; otherwise, they may turn out soggy.

  3. In a mixing bowl, combine the grated zucchini, salt, black pepper, garlic powder, onion powder, flour, and Parmesan cheese.
  4. Add the beaten egg to the mixture and stir until everything is well combined.
  5. Preheat your air fryer to 375°F (190°C) for about 3-5 minutes.
  6. Spray the air fryer basket with cooking spray to prevent sticking.
  7. Using a spoon, scoop out portions of the zucchini mixture and form them into small patties. Place them in the air fryer basket, being careful not to overcrowd.
  8. Air fry the fritters for 10-12 minutes or until they are golden brown and crispy, flipping them halfway through the cooking time.
  9. Pro Tip: Flipping the fritters halfway ensures even cooking and a perfectly crispy exterior.

  10. Remove the fritters from the air fryer and allow them to cool slightly before serving.
  11. Serve warm with your favorite dipping sauce.

How to Serve and Store

These zucchini fritters are versatile and can be served with various dipping sauces, such as tzatziki, ranch, or marinara sauce. They are best enjoyed fresh and warm from the air fryer. If you have leftovers, store them in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days.

For freezing, you can freeze the uncooked patties on a baking sheet and then transfer them to a freezer bag. They will last up to 2 months. When you’re ready to eat, cook them from frozen in the air fryer, adding a couple of extra minutes to the cooking time.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I bake zucchini fritters instead of using an air fryer?

Yes, you can bake them at 400°F (200°C) for about 20-25 minutes, flipping halfway through.

Are these zucchini fritters gluten-free?

They can be made gluten-free by substituting all-purpose flour with almond flour or a gluten-free blend.

How do I prevent soggy fritters?

Make sure to squeeze out as much moisture from the zucchini as possible before mixing.

Can I use frozen zucchini for this recipe?

Fresh zucchini is recommended, but if using frozen, thaw and drain thoroughly before using.

What are the best dipping sauces for zucchini fritters?

Popular choices include tzatziki, ranch dressing, or a spicy aioli.

How long do leftover zucchini fritters last in the fridge?

They will last up to 3 days in the fridge when stored in an airtight container.
